What Types of Coverage Should You Know About?
What types of coverage are crucial for individuals to consider? Understanding various coverage choices is vital for financial security. Medical coverage is essential, providing protection for healthcare costs and preventative care, thereby protecting against unforeseen health problems. Auto insurance is another important type, guarding against car damage and liability in the case of an accident. Property or tenant coverage provides protection for private belongings and liability, ensuring peace of mind for those who own or lease a home.
Life insurance stays necessary, extending financial protection to beneficiaries in case of untimely death. Similarly, disability insurance can compensate for lost income during periods of disability, helping individuals maintain their standard of living. Business insurance is critical for entrepreneurs, covering potential risks part of running a business. Each type of insurance serves a specific purpose, and individuals should assess their needs to determine the right coverage for their circumstances.

Evaluating Coverage Requirements
As individuals approach the intricate scene of insurance options, understanding their specific coverage needs becomes important for guaranteeing both affordability and reliability. Identifying personal circumstances, such as the size of the family, health status, and financial circumstances, helps adjust coverage properly. Individuals should analyze potential risks, including property damage, medical matters, and liability issues, to determine necessary coverage levels. Moreover, considering state requirements and industry standards can direct choices, maintaining conformity while avoiding unnecessary expenses. By giving preference to essential coverage over extra options, consumers can concentrate on the most relevant policies for their situation. A well-defined assessment of coverage needs not only supports finding the right coverage but also enhances peace of mind, confident in their protection.
Contrasting Protection Quotes
When looking for budget-friendly and dependable insurance protection, individuals often question which quotes best align with their requirements. Comparing insurance quotes is a vital component in this procedure. By collecting multiple quotes, consumers can examine different premiums, coverage limits, and deductibles. It is important to review not only the cost but also the standing of each insurer, as customer service and claims processing can significantly impact overall contentment. Digital comparison platforms and local agents can assist in this effort, providing a clearer picture of available options. Furthermore, individuals should take into account any discounts for combining coverage or maintaining a good claims history. Ultimately, thorough comparison helps guarantee that individuals make informed decisions customized to their specific circumstances.

What Results if I Fail to Pay a Policy Payment?
If a required payment is missed, the policyholder may experience a grace period before coverage lapses. After that, the insurance could be canceled, leading to likely fiscal consequences and difficulties in obtaining new policies.
When Should I Assess My Insurance Policy? How Frequently is Suggested?
People should evaluate their insurance plans annually or following significant life events, such as tying the knot or home purchase. Frequent evaluations guarantee protection continues appropriate and relevant, responding to shifting conditions and financial needs over time.
